The Dow Adds 5 Points, Nasdaq Gains 13
The Dow added 5.13 points today to close at 11,469.28, the Nasdaq gained 12.54 points to close at 2,205.70 and the S&P 500 added 2.24 points to close at 1,313.25. The major indexes traded close to the flat line as traders starting making their way back from the holiday weekend. However, individual stories spattered the headlines throughout the day. Chevron (NYSE: CVX) and Devon (NYSE: DVN) reported a major new oil source in the Gulf of Mexico, Intel (Nasdaq: INTC) cuts thousands of jobs,
Ford (NYSE: C) CEO and Chairman, Bill Ford, steps down and Phelps Dodge (NYSE: PD) receives $125 million payment from Inco (NYSE: N) after merger plans fall through. Oil closed down $0.59 to $68.60.
Volume was modest with 1.34 billion shares trading on the NYSE and 1.79 billion on the Nasdaq. Advancers topped decliners by a margin of 19:14 on the NYSE and 18:12 on the Nasdaq.
In individual stories, Click Commerce, Inc. (Nasdaq: CKCM) closed 25.6% higher after Illinois Tool Works Inc. (NYSE: ITW) made a cash tender offer to acquire all of the outstanding shares of Click Commerce. As part of the agreement, ITW would purchase all of Click Commerce's outstanding shares for $22.75 per share. Adolor Corporation (Nasdaq: ADLR) fell 45.3% after announcing top-line results from two identically designed Phase 3 registration studies (012 and 013) of alvimopan (Entereg/Entrareg) for the treatment of opioid-induced bowel dysfunction (OBD) in patients with chronic non-cancer pain. The Study 013 did not achieve statistical significance. Study 012 achieved statistical significance in its primary endpoint.
Tomorrow, investors will be looking for earnings from ABM Industries (NYSE: ABM), Aspen Technology (Nasdaq: ASPN), Casella Waste (Nasdaq: CWST), FuelCell Energy (Nasdaq: FCEL) and Hovnanian Enterprises Inc. (NYSE: HOV). Traders will be looking for economic data U.S. Non-Farm Productivity (8:30AM EST), ISM Services (10:00AM EST), and Federal Reserve's Beige Book (2:00PM EST).
